About This Role:

The Site Head of Engineering & Facilities (Sr. Director level) is responsible for managing all engineering & facilities at Biogen's RTP Pharma site supporting manufacturing, laboratory, office, and the rest of site infrastructure operations.  This role is accountable for directing a team of highly technical professionals managing & executing activities in Manufacturing Engineering (includes ownership of process CQV), Facilities Engineering (includes ownership of clean utility and HVAC CQV), Manufacturing Maintenance, Facilities & Utilities Operations & Maintenance, Instrumentation & Controls, Maintenance Reliability, work order management, equipment asset lifecycle from user requirement specifications, design, installation, CQV testing, maintenance, spare parts management, engineering document management, decommissioning at the site, general site services and GMP/non-GMP cleaning. This role is also accountable for managing and executing the small capital project portfolio and representing the site in large capital projects at the site. 

This role is expected to actively participate as a key member of the Site Leadership Team and the Biogen PO&T Global Engineering & Facilities Leadership Team.  

What You'll Do:

  • Provide Supervision and direction to functional teams for planning, execution, and prioritization of activities to support the daily manufacturing processes and schedule.  Includes oversight of shutdown planning /execution and management / execution of the site’s small capital project portfolio.  Monitor the performance of department goals and manage a direct staff of 6-8 personnel.  Develop, communicate, and implement strategic goals in support of Manufacturing Operations, 24/7 Utility Operations and Facility Utilization.  Includes accountability for Business Continuity (Emergency Response, Emergency Recovery, and Business Impact Assessments along with Risk and Criticality Assessments) planning and execution for equipment and systems at the site.
  • Maintain compliance overall, with Corporate and Site Policies, cGMP, EHS, GEP/GES, and other regulations applicable locally and to the jurisdictional guidance within the scope of the role for all supporting functions. Drive a compliance-focused mindset into the organization by holding individuals personally accountable for their own compliance/safety and the compliance of others impacted by their work. Drive continual development of compliance/safety practices within the organization. Present engineering, facilities, validation, maintenance, pest control, cleaning, automation programs and deliverables to regulatory agencies. Ensure adherence to Quality Management System Global Directives, Global Engineering Systems guidance and best practices; procedures and best practices across sites are aligned as appropriate.  Ensure 24/7 coverage of site utilities and alarm management.
  • Support Technology Transfers and the related equipment design, installation, commissioning, qualification, and validation (cleaning and CSV) activities to support the manufacturing schedule.
  • Forecast and manage operational and site small capital expense budgets. Identify and implement system improvements and capital upgrades. Partner with Site leadership to plan and approve capital projects.
